Udemy
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
Development
Web Development Data Science Mobile Development Programming Languages Game Development Database Design & Development Software Testing Software Engineering Development Tools No-Code Development
Business
Entrepreneurship Communications Management Sales Business Strategy Operations Project Management Business Law Business Analytics & Intelligence Human Resources Industry E-Commerce Media Real Estate Other Business
Finance & Accounting
Accounting & Bookkeeping Compliance Cryptocurrency & Blockchain Economics Finance Finance Cert & Exam Prep Financial Modeling & Analysis Investing & Trading Money Management Tools Taxes Other Finance & Accounting
IT & Software
IT Certification Network & Security Hardware Operating Systems Other IT & Software
Office Productivity
Microsoft Apple Google SAP Oracle Other Office Productivity
Personal Development
Personal Transformation Personal Productivity Leadership Career Development Parenting & Relationships Happiness Esoteric Practices Religion & Spirituality Personal Brand Building Creativity Influence Self Esteem & Confidence Stress Management Memory & Study Skills Motivation Other Personal Development
Design
Web Design Graphic Design & Illustration Design Tools User Experience Design Game Design Design Thinking 3D & Animation Fashion Design Architectural Design Interior Design Other Design
Marketing
Digital Marketing Search Engine Optimization Social Media Marketing Branding Marketing Fundamentals Marketing Analytics & Automation Public Relations Advertising Video & Mobile Marketing Content Marketing Growth Hacking Affiliate Marketing Product Marketing Other Marketing
Lifestyle
Arts & Crafts Beauty & Makeup Esoteric Practices Food & Beverage Gaming Home Improvement Pet Care & Training Travel Other Lifestyle
Photography & Video
Digital Photography Photography Portrait Photography Photography Tools Commercial Photography Video Design Other Photography & Video
Health & Fitness
Fitness General Health Sports Nutrition Yoga Mental Health Dieting Self Defense Safety & First Aid Dance Meditation Other Health & Fitness
Music
Instruments Music Production Music Fundamentals Vocal Music Techniques Music Software Other Music
Teaching & Academics
Engineering Humanities Math Science Online Education Social Science Language Teacher Training Test Prep Other Teaching & Academics
AWS Certification Microsoft Certification AWS Certified Solutions Architect - Associate AWS Certified Cloud Practitioner CompTIA A+ Cisco CCNA Amazon AWS CompTIA Security+ AWS Certified Developer - Associate
Graphic Design Photoshop Adobe Illustrator Drawing Digital Painting InDesign Character Design Canva Figure Drawing
Life Coach Training Neuro-Linguistic Programming Personal Development Mindfulness Meditation Personal Transformation Life Purpose Emotional Intelligence Neuroscience
Web Development JavaScript React CSS Angular PHP WordPress Node.Js Python
Google Flutter Android Development iOS Development Swift React Native Dart Programming Language Mobile Development Kotlin SwiftUI
Digital Marketing Google Ads (Adwords) Social Media Marketing Google Ads (AdWords) Certification Marketing Strategy Internet Marketing YouTube Marketing Email Marketing Google Analytics
SQL Microsoft Power BI Tableau Business Analysis Business Intelligence MySQL Data Modeling Data Analysis Big Data
Business Fundamentals Entrepreneurship Fundamentals Business Strategy Online Business Business Plan Startup Freelancing Blogging Home Business
Unity Game Development Fundamentals Unreal Engine C# 3D Game Development C++ 2D Game Development Unreal Engine Blueprints Blender
30-Day Money-Back Guarantee
Development Programming Languages Python

how2Py 101 - Beginners Python Crash Course

Straight to the minimal basics that you need to start writing Python Programs !
Rating: 4.3 out of 54.3 (110 ratings)
13,438 students
Created by Vishu Kamble
Last updated 6/2020
English
30-Day Money-Back Guarantee

What you'll learn

  • Learn and understand the very basics of Python.
  • How to code simple programs in Python
  • How to use Python to GET data from website and parse it.

Course content

15 sections • 77 lectures • 6h 55m total length

  • Preview04:51

  • Preview04:23
  • Installing Python on Mac
    02:14
  • Installing Python on Linux
    01:38

  • Compilers and Interpreters
    03:20
  • What are functions
    03:47
  • Functions vs Methods
    00:25
  • DataTypes in Python
    05:07
  • DataTypes
    6 questions
  • Variables - Introduction
    08:24
  • Variables Quiz
    4 questions
  • String Functions 101
    09:23
  • Installing PyCharm - IDE
    05:11
  • How to take input from users
    07:30
  • Input Quiz
    2 questions

  • Preview06:07
  • User's Age - 2
    09:53
  • Preview04:18
  • Birth Year - 2
    05:37
  • Birth Year - 3
    04:46
  • Birth Year - 4
    04:34
  • Birth Year - 5
    07:03
  • Birth Year - 6
    06:58
  • Tip Calculator
    06:51
  • Find User's Wage - 1
    04:31
  • Find User's Wage - 2
    03:38
  • Find User's Wage - 3
    01:13

  • For Loop - Introduction
    06:55
  • For Loops - Example
    06:09
  • For Loops - Step
    02:46

  • List Introduction
    06:43
  • List functions
    05:48
  • Using Lists
    05:32
  • List insert
    03:35
  • Practical Use Case for Lists - 1
    05:10
  • Practical Use Case for Lists - 2
    06:10
  • Practical Use Case for Lists - 2
    03:16
  • Practical Use Case for Lists - 3
    07:25

  • Working with files
    05:09
  • List Split
    04:41
  • Get IP Addresses
    05:29
  • Get IP And Date
    06:00
  • Get IP and Status Code
    08:09

  • Setting up calculator - basics
    04:25
  • Setting up calculator - 2
    05:26
  • Adding 'add' function
    05:47
  • Adding all functions
    05:01
  • Printing inside functions
    05:11
  • Difference between print and return
    06:01

  • Find max number - 1
    06:27
  • Find max number - 2
    05:47

  • Dictionaries - Introduction
    05:53
  • Using dictionaries
    04:15
  • Printing Dictionaries
    05:37
  • Dictionary Keys
    03:50

Requirements

  • Enthusiastic about learning

Description

Hey Everyone,

Welcome to how2Py 101! Often times I got messages from my friends and collogues saying even though there are tons of resources to learn python on the internet, almost everyone just gave up because it was too much at once.

This course is totally focused on the beginners who have never done programming but want to learn it.

I focus on only the core things you need to start programming in python.

The Essentials.

This course is not for a Certification preparation.

This course is not a deep dive into Python.


This course is meant to be short and simple to let you get started on coding.

Once you start, things will come to you as you practice. You'll start understanding codes.

How to solve problems. Unfortunately, most beginners courses try to teach everything at once, often overwhelming everyone and leading to students giving up before reaching this point.

Which is why I kept all the videos short - 4 to 7 minutes and tried to cover only the basics you need to start programming.


Like always, if you ever need any help, please do not hesitate.

If you have any audio/video problems or have suggestions, feel free to message me!

If you love the course or hate the course, let me know :)

Who this course is for:

  • Everyone who is interested in learning Python.

Instructor

Vishu Kamble
Infrastructure Engineer
Vishu Kamble
  • 4.4 Instructor Rating
  • 834 Reviews
  • 57,379 Students
  • 5 Courses

Hey!

I am Vishu, currently working as an Infrastructure Engineer in a hedge fund in London. I have a Masters in Computer Science with specialization in Cloud Computing and a Bachelors in Computer Engineering. Always learning new things and am super passionate about technology and the cloud.

I am putting courses on Python and AWS where you can learn Python and AWS while building projects so you have an better understanding of how things work on the cloud and also have shit to show in your resumes. 

If you get stuck, hit me up anywhere anytime.

#Savage

  • Udemy for Business
  • Teach on Udemy
  • Get the app
  • About us
  • Contact us
  • Careers
  • Blog
  • Help and Support
  • Affiliate
  • Impressum Kontakt
  • Terms
  • Privacy policy
  • Cookie settings
  • Sitemap
  • Featured courses
Udemy
© 2021 Udemy, Inc.